Hello everyone,
I just built a new pc but when I boot I get no video signal. The CPU and the case fan start spinning so there is power going to them. I have tried the steps mentioned in this topic: http://www.tomshardware.co.uk/forum/261145-31-perform-s...
However, it's still not working.
Here are the specs of the pc:
PSU: FSP Group ATX-250PA
CPU: Intel i3-4150 3,5 Ghz (with onboard graphics)
Motherboard: Asrock H87M Pro4
RAM: Ballistix 8 GB Kit (4GB DDR3L -1600 CL8) VLP UDIMM Tactical
SSD: Cricial MX100
Optical drive: Samsung SH118BB/BEBE

I have also tried to boot with the SSD and the optical drive disconnected, and tried booting using an old video card I had laying around (AMD HD5450), but both without succes.

It needs P2.00 of the BIOS to support that CPU

1150 Core i3 i3-4150 (C0) Haswell-R 3.5GHz 3MB 54W P2.00

So if this isnt on it now, it wont do anything

Only way you can get it on it, is take it into a shop and ask them to flash it with a lower spec CPU then flash it

Or you'll have to buy a lower spec cpu then flash it then put yours back in. If the right BIOS isnt on it
